In this video, we push the limits of Socket 7 by benchmarking the legendary Intel Pentium "Tillamook" 266 overclocked to 350 MHz on a modified ASUS P5A-B motherboard.
The Tillamook is a mobile Pentium MMX built on a 0.25-micron process, allowing it to run cooler and clock higher than almost any other P55C. But can it actually beat the AMD K6-2 and K6-III in real-world gaming? We put it to the test against the K6-2, K6-III, Pentium II, and Celeron across a suite of classic benchmarks.
Benchmarks Included:
- 3D Games: Unreal, Quake, Quake II, and DOOM
- Synthetics: 3DMark99 and SpeedSys
Is this the ultimate "hidden gem" for Super Socket 7 builds, or does the Slot 1 architecture still reign supreme? Let’s dive into the results!
